Startups Stick with Organic vs Paid Search Results

Startup Professionals Musings

What most people don’t realize is that, according to new research , 90% of search engine users rarely look at the paid results. Paid search engine ranking (PPC) is buying advertising for your business from Google or another search engine company. This is NOT the same as Search Engine Optimization (SEO).
